Transaction 47a93ab786f2442df2631358ec0ee336b9447f25ee7fe912d160aa153b21c854
1 Input
1 Output
-
47a93ab786f2442df2631358ec0ee336b9447f25ee7fe912d160aa153b21c854:0
- value
- 3316652
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d85825ecedead9b4d9e06df229583cbb4234fb5
- address
- bc1qekzcyhkwm6keknv7qm0j99vrew6zxna44qhh82